WebMay 1, 2016 · Executive Summary. Healthcare organizations conduct culture of safety surveys to assess staff perceptions about their patient safety climate. The findings can help an organization identify areas for improving the patient safety culture, but they must be thoughtfully implemented and supported by leadership to achieve lasting change. WebNov 29, 2011 · Occupational safety and health culture, or more briefly 'OSH culture', can be seen as a concept for exploring how informal organisational aspects influence OSH in a positive or negative way.
